F990 TSG is a 1988 Austin Mini Mayfair Auto in White with a 998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.6%.
Across all 1988 Austin Mini Mayfair Auto models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.9% with a typical mileage of 40,471 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Austin Mini Mayfair Auto fails its MOT is subframe m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 613 recorded failures. If you're considering buying F990 TSG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Austin Mini Mayfair Auto typically stays on UK roads for around 44 years. At 38 years old, this Austin Mini Mayfair Auto is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
